Which of the following equations has the same solution as m - (-62) = 45?

m - (-62) = 45 is the special equation so I'm a solve it and look for the same answer of the other options, so below is my work on how i got the answer of the special equation.

m + 62 = 45
m = 45 - 62
m = -17

The answer would be choice A) x + 25 = 8 and the x in that equation is -17 and -17 + 25 = 8 and that's true, and i figured out the answer by subtracting 25 from both sides and subtracting 8 - 25 so it can be -17.
